
ESPN has some pretty high claims here, calling their new hardware The Ultimate Remote. It features Wi-Fi connectivity to complement advanced home theater control as well as one-touch real-time access to sports, standings, team information and news, so are all those features worth the $300 you’re supposed to fork out for it? This nifty gadget can manage home theater components, set top boxes and IP equipment with intuitive “location-free” setup and one-handed operation – perfect for couch potatoes who need the free hand to feed themselves with slices of pizza, chips and beer.
